遥感数据提取方法技术

技术编号:39653661 阅读:14 留言:0更新日期:2023-12-09 11:22
本发明专利技术涉及遥感通信技术领域,公开了一种遥感数据提取方法

【技术实现步骤摘要】
遥感数据提取方法、装置、设备及存储介质


[0001]本专利技术涉及遥感通信
,尤其涉及一种遥感数据提取方法

装置

设备及存储介质


技术介绍

[0002]随着数据时代的到来,各种信息数据呈现出急速增长的趋势

在遥感通信
,卫星的遥感数据一般具有数据量大的特点,由于遥感数据不断积累以及数据信息极为复杂,整个数据集变得越来越难以处理

并且由于遥感数据通过多个信道从卫星向地面传输,同一个任务可能在任意位置被拆分为多个数据下传

地面接收到的数据可能为多个卫星,不同任务混合的数据

如何正确快速的从大量数据中提取出遥感数据,并将其恢复原始任务数据,是遥感数据分析与应用的前提

[0003]但是传统的对数据提取大部分采用按照帧头或帧同步字提取,然后按照帧计数进行排序拼接的方式,由于遥感数据时效性在天气预测

灾害救援等应用场景中较为重要,该方式对于遥感数据的提取速度仍较慢,降低了遥感数据的时效性

[0004]上述内容仅用于辅助理解本专利技术的技术方案,并不代表承认上述内容是现有技术


技术实现思路

[0005]本专利技术的主要目的在于提供了一种遥感数据提取方法

装置

设备及存储介质,旨在解决传统的采用按照帧头或帧同步字提取,然后按照帧计数进行排序拼接的方式对于遥感数据的提取速度仍较慢,降低了遥感数据的时效性的技术问题

[0006]为实现上述目的,本专利技术提供了一种遥感数据提取方法,所述方法包括以下步骤:
[0007]对接收到的卫星遥感数据进行索引创建,获得倒排索引数据;
[0008]根据所述倒排索引数据对所述卫星遥感数据进行数据预处理,获得各帧目标遥感数据;
[0009]对所述各帧目标遥感数据进行数据合并,获得可用遥感数据

[0010]可选地,所述对接收到的卫星遥感数据进行索引创建,获得倒排索引数据,包括:
[0011]通过消息队列对接收到的卫星遥感数据进行分流,获得分流遥感数据;
[0012]基于
Lucene
库对所述分流遥感数据进行分词处理,获得所述分流遥感数据对应的分词数据;
[0013]根据所述分词数据对所述卫星遥感数据进行索引创建,获得倒排索引数据

[0014]可选地,所述根据所述倒排索引数据对所述卫星遥感数据进行数据预处理,获得各帧目标遥感数据,包括:
[0015]根据所述倒排索引数据对所述卫星遥感数据进行帧查询,获得所述卫星遥感数据对应的遥感帧头;
[0016]通过相似度匹配算法对所述遥感帧头和所述倒排索引数据进行相似度匹配,获得
所述遥感帧头和所述倒排索引数据之间的相似度值;
[0017]通过所述相似度值对所述卫星遥感数据中的帧数据进行数据修复,获得各帧目标遥感数据

[0018]可选地,所述通过相似度匹配算法对所述遥感帧头和所述倒排索引数据进行相似度匹配,获得所述遥感帧头和所述倒排索引数据之间的相似度值,包括:
[0019]将所述遥感帧头和所述倒排索引数据进行向量映射,获得所述遥感帧头对应的帧头向量和所述倒排索引数据对应的索引向量;
[0020]对所述帧头向量和所述索引向量分别进行向量角度处理,获得所述帧头向量之间的帧向量角度和所述索引向量之间的索引向量角度;
[0021]通过相似度匹配算法对所述帧向量角度和所述索引向量角度进行相似度匹配,获得所述遥感帧头和所述倒排索引数据之间的相似度值

[0022]可选地,所述通过所述相似度值对所述卫星遥感数据中的帧数据进行数据修复,获得各帧目标遥感数据,包括:
[0023]判断所述相似度值是否大于预设阈值,将大于所述预设阈值所对应的遥感帧头作为帧头预选点;
[0024]判断相邻帧头预选点之间的帧距离是否达到预设帧长度;
[0025]在存在所述帧距离未达到所述预设帧长度的情况下,按预设数据格式对未达到所述预设帧长度对应的遥感帧头进行数据修正,获得修正后的卫星遥感数据;
[0026]对所述修正后的卫星遥感数据中的帧数据进行数据提取,获得各帧目标遥感数据

[0027]可选地,所述对所述各帧目标遥感数据进行数据合并,获得可用遥感数据,包括:
[0028]提取所述卫星遥感数据的任务时间;
[0029]根据所述任务时间对所述各帧目标遥感数据进行排序,获得排序数据;
[0030]对所述排序数据中的各帧数据进行定位,获得所述帧数据在字节中的字节结束位置;
[0031]根据所述字节结束位置对所述排序数据进行数据合并,获得可用遥感数据

[0032]可选地,所述根据所述字节结束位置对所述排序数据进行数据合并,获得可用遥感数据,包括:
[0033]根据所述字节结束位置对所述各帧数据进行偏移测算,获得所述各帧数据对应的数据偏移量;
[0034]在所述数据偏移量达到预设偏移量时,对达到所述预设偏移量所对应的各帧数据进行帧截取,获得截取后的帧数据;
[0035]根据所述字节结束位置对所述排序数据和所述截取后的帧数据进行数据合并,获得可用遥感数据

[0036]此外,为实现上述目的,本专利技术还提出一种遥感数据提取装置,所述装置包括:
[0037]倒排索引模块,用于对接收到的卫星遥感数据进行索引创建,获得倒排索引数据;
[0038]数据提取模块,用于根据所述倒排索引数据对所述卫星遥感数据进行数据预处理,获得各帧目标遥感数据;
[0039]数据合并模块,用于对所述各帧目标遥感数据进行数据合并,获得可用遥感数据

[0040]此外,为实现上述目的,本专利技术还提出一种遥感数据提取设备,所述设备包括:存储器

处理器及存储在所述存储器上并可在所述处理器上运行的遥感数据提取程序,所述遥感数据提取程序配置为实现如上文所述的遥感数据提取方法的步骤

[0041]此外,为实现上述目的,本专利技术还提出一种存储介质,所述存储介质上存储有遥感数据提取程序,所述遥感数据提取程序被处理器执行时实现如上文所述的遥感数据提取方法的步骤

[0042]本专利技术通过对接收到的卫星遥感数据进行索引创建,获得倒排索引数据;然后根据所述倒排索引数据对所述卫星遥感数据进行数据预处理,获得各帧目标遥感数据;最后对所述各帧目标遥感数据进行数据合并,获得可用遥感数据

由于本专利技术通过对卫星遥感数据创建倒排索引数据,在对遥感数据进行数据提取时,可通过倒排索引数据找到卫星遥感数据的具体位置,避免了传统的按照帧头提取并按照帧计数进行排序拼接方式的慢速度提取情况,提高了数据提取的效率,从本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种遥感数据提取方法,其特征在于,所述遥感数据提取方法包括:对接收到的卫星遥感数据进行索引创建,获得倒排索引数据;根据所述倒排索引数据对所述卫星遥感数据进行数据预处理,获得各帧目标遥感数据;对所述各帧目标遥感数据进行数据合并,获得可用遥感数据
。2.
如权利要求1所述的遥感数据提取方法,其特征在于,所述对接收到的卫星遥感数据进行索引创建,获得倒排索引数据,包括:通过消息队列对接收到的卫星遥感数据进行分流,获得分流遥感数据;基于
Lucene
库对所述分流遥感数据进行分词处理,获得所述分流遥感数据对应的分词数据;根据所述分词数据对所述卫星遥感数据进行索引创建,获得倒排索引数据
。3.
如权利要求1所述的遥感数据提取方法,其特征在于,所述根据所述倒排索引数据对所述卫星遥感数据进行数据预处理,获得各帧目标遥感数据,包括:根据所述倒排索引数据对所述卫星遥感数据进行帧查询,获得所述卫星遥感数据对应的遥感帧头;通过相似度匹配算法对所述遥感帧头和所述倒排索引数据进行相似度匹配,获得所述遥感帧头和所述倒排索引数据之间的相似度值;通过所述相似度值对所述卫星遥感数据中的帧数据进行数据修复,获得各帧目标遥感数据
。4.
如权利要求3所述的遥感数据提取方法,其特征在于,所述通过相似度匹配算法对所述遥感帧头和所述倒排索引数据进行相似度匹配,获得所述遥感帧头和所述倒排索引数据之间的相似度值,包括:将所述遥感帧头和所述倒排索引数据进行向量映射,获得所述遥感帧头对应的帧头向量和所述倒排索引数据对应的索引向量;对所述帧头向量和所述索引向量分别进行向量角度处理,获得所述帧头向量之间的帧向量角度和所述索引向量之间的索引向量角度;通过相似度匹配算法对所述帧向量角度和所述索引向量角度进行相似度匹配,获得所述遥感帧头和所述倒排索引数据之间的相似度值
。5.
如权利要求4所述的遥感数据提取方法,其特征在于,所述通过所述相似度值对所述卫星遥感数据中的帧数据进行数据修复,获得各帧目标遥感数据,包括:判断所述相似度值是否大于预设阈值,将大于所述预设阈值所对应的遥感帧头作为...

【专利技术属性】
技术研发人员:杜杰
申请(专利权)人:浙江吉利控股集团有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1